Position Summary

Unlimited Behavior Solutions (UBS) is seeking compassionate, motivated, and enthusiastic Behavior Therapists to join our growing clinical team. At UBS, we believe meaningful change occurs through respectful, individualized support that helps people build independence, confidence, and a life aligned with their own goals and values.

Behavior Therapists work directly with adolescents and adults with autism spectrum disorder and other developmental disabilities across home, community, vocational, and social settings. Services focus on increasing independence, communication, self-advocacy, emotional regulation, social relationships, adaptive living skills, and community participation.

This is an excellent opportunity for individuals pursuing careers in Applied Behavior Analysis, psychology, education, counseling, social work, or related fields.

What You’ll Do

As a Behavior Therapist, you will:

  • Implement individualized behavior support and skill acquisition programs developed by a BCBA.
  • Teach communication, social, adaptive living, vocational, and community participation skills.
  • Support individuals during community outings, recreational activities, employment, and daily living routines.
  • Collect accurate behavioral and skill acquisition data using electronic data collection systems.
  • Assist clients in developing coping strategies, emotional regulation, and problem-solving skills.
  • Implement proactive, positive behavior support strategies that reduce the need for restrictive interventions.
  • Collaborate with families, caregivers, support staff, and interdisciplinary professionals.
  • Participate in team meetings, clinical trainings, and ongoing professional development.
  • Maintain professional documentation while following ethical and confidentiality standards.
  • Represent UBS with professionalism, compassion, and respect in every interaction.
